Description

Diazepam Binding Inhibitor (39-75) CAS NO 153858-87-8 is a synthetic peptide fragment derived from the endogenous Diazepam Binding Inhibitor (DBI), a protein that modulates the activity of GABA-A receptors. This specific sequence is a critical research tool for investigating the neurobiological mechanisms of anxiety, stress response, and the regulation of benzodiazepine binding sites. It is essential for pharmaceutical R&D, academic neuroscience, and biotechnology laboratories focused on CNS drug discovery and neuropeptide signaling pathways.

Application

  • Neuroscience Research: Used as a selective ligand to study the interaction between endogenous peptides and the GABA-A/benzodiazepine receptor complex.
  • Drug Discovery & Development: Serves as a reference standard and pharmacological tool in screening assays for novel anxiolytics, anticonvulsants, and neurosteroids.
  • Biochemical Studies: Employed in competitive binding assays (e.g., radioligand binding) to characterize receptor subtypes and binding affinities.
  • Mechanistic Pharmacology: Facilitates research into the role of DBI in stress, anxiety, and seizure disorders by modulating allosteric sites on GABA receptors.
  • Peptide Chemistry & Proteomics: Acts as a substrate or standard in enzymatic degradation studies and mass spectrometry analysis of neuropeptides.

Storage

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Store at -20°C or below in a dry environment. This product is hygroscopic (moisture-sensitive). For long-term storage, it is recommended to keep the lyophilized powder desiccated. Av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les of reconstituted solutions.
